/*
* Copyright (c) 2024 ETH Zürich, IT Services
*
* This Source Code Form is subject to the terms of the Mozilla Public
* License, v. 2.0. If a copy of the MPL was not distributed with this
* file, You can obtain one at http://mozilla.org/MPL/2.0/.
*/
using System;
using System.Threading;
using Microsoft.VisualStudio.TestTools.UnitTesting;
using Moq;
using SafeExamBrowser.Communication.Contracts;
using SafeExamBrowser.Communication.Contracts.Data;
using SafeExamBrowser.Communication.Contracts.Events;
using SafeExamBrowser.Communication.Contracts.Hosts;
using SafeExamBrowser.Configuration.Contracts;
using SafeExamBrowser.Logging.Contracts;
using SafeExamBrowser.Service.Communication;
namespace SafeExamBrowser.Service.UnitTests.Communication
{
[TestClass]
public class ServiceHostTests
{
private Mock<IHostObject> hostObject;
private Mock<IHostObjectFactory> hostObjectFactory;
private Mock<ILogger> logger;
private ServiceHost sut;
[TestInitialize]
public void Initialize()
{
hostObject = new Mock<IHostObject>();
hostObjectFactory = new Mock<IHostObjectFactory>();
logger = new Mock<ILogger>();
hostObjectFactory.Setup(f => f.CreateObject(It.IsAny<string>(), It.IsAny<ICommunication>())).Returns(hostObject.Object);
sut = new ServiceHost("net:pipe://some/address", hostObjectFactory.Object, logger.Object, 0);
}
[TestMethod]
public void Connect_MustAllowFirstConnnectionAndDenyFurtherRequests()
{
var response = sut.Connect();
var response2 = sut.Connect();
var response3 = sut.Connect();
Assert.IsTrue(response.ConnectionEstablished);
Assert.IsFalse(response2.ConnectionEstablished);
Assert.IsFalse(response3.ConnectionEstablished);
}
[TestMethod]
public void Disconnect_MustDisconnectAndThenAllowNewConnection()
{
var connect = sut.Connect();
var disconnect = sut.Disconnect(new DisconnectionMessage { CommunicationToken = connect.CommunicationToken.Value, Interlocutor = Interlocutor.Runtime });
Assert.IsTrue(disconnect.ConnectionTerminated);
var connect2 = sut.Connect();
Assert.IsTrue(connect2.ConnectionEstablished);
}
[TestMethod]
public void Send_MustHandleSystemConfigurationUpdate()
{
var sync = new AutoResetEvent(false);
var systemConfigurationUpdateRequested = false;
sut.SystemConfigurationUpdateRequested += () => { systemConfigurationUpdateRequested = true; sync.Set(); };
var token = sut.Connect().CommunicationToken.Value;
var message = new SimpleMessage(SimpleMessagePurport.UpdateSystemConfiguration) { CommunicationToken = token };
var response = sut.Send(message);
sync.WaitOne();
Assert.IsTrue(systemConfigurationUpdateRequested);
Assert.IsNotNull(response);
Assert.IsInstanceOfType(response, typeof(SimpleResponse));
Assert.AreEqual(SimpleResponsePurport.Acknowledged, (response as SimpleResponse)?.Purport);
}
[TestMethod]
public void Send_MustHandleSessionStartRequest()
{
var args = default(SessionStartEventArgs);
var sync = new AutoResetEvent(false);
var configuration = new ServiceConfiguration { SessionId = Guid.NewGuid() };
var sessionStartRequested = false;
sut.SessionStartRequested += (a) => { args = a; sessionStartRequested = true; sync.Set(); };
var token = sut.Connect().CommunicationToken.Value;
var message = new SessionStartMessage(configuration) { CommunicationToken = token };
var response = sut.Send(message);
sync.WaitOne();
Assert.IsTrue(sessionStartRequested);
Assert.IsNotNull(args);
Assert.IsNotNull(response);
Assert.IsInstanceOfType(response, typeof(SimpleResponse));
Assert.AreEqual(configuration.SessionId, args.Configuration.SessionId);
Assert.AreEqual(SimpleResponsePurport.Acknowledged, (response as SimpleResponse)?.Purport);
}
[TestMethod]
public void Send_MustHandleSessionStopRequest()
{
var args = default(SessionStopEventArgs);
var sync = new AutoResetEvent(false);
var sessionId = Guid.NewGuid();
var sessionStopRequested = false;
sut.SessionStopRequested += (a) => { args = a; sessionStopRequested = true; sync.Set(); };
var token = sut.Connect().CommunicationToken.Value;
var message = new SessionStopMessage(sessionId) { CommunicationToken = token };
var response = sut.Send(message);
sync.WaitOne();
Assert.IsTrue(sessionStopRequested);
Assert.IsNotNull(args);
Assert.IsNotNull(response);
Assert.IsInstanceOfType(response, typeof(SimpleResponse));
Assert.AreEqual(sessionId, args.SessionId);
Assert.AreEqual(SimpleResponsePurport.Acknowledged, (response as SimpleResponse)?.Purport);
}
[TestMethod]
public void Send_MustReturnUnknownMessageAsDefault()
{
var token = sut.Connect().CommunicationToken.Value;
var message = new TestMessage { CommunicationToken = token } as Message;
var response = sut.Send(message);
Assert.IsNotNull(response);
Assert.IsInstanceOfType(response, typeof(SimpleResponse));
Assert.AreEqual(SimpleResponsePurport.UnknownMessage, (response as SimpleResponse)?.Purport);
message = new SimpleMessage(default(SimpleMessagePurport)) { CommunicationToken = token };
response = sut.Send(message);
Assert.IsNotNull(response);
Assert.IsInstanceOfType(response, typeof(SimpleResponse));
Assert.AreEqual(SimpleResponsePurport.UnknownMessage, (response as SimpleResponse)?.Purport);
}
[TestMethod]
public void MustNotFailIfNoEventHandlersSubscribed()
{
var token = sut.Connect(Guid.Empty).CommunicationToken.Value;
sut.Send(new SessionStartMessage(null) { CommunicationToken = token });
sut.Send(new SessionStopMessage(Guid.Empty) { CommunicationToken = token });
sut.Disconnect(new DisconnectionMessage { CommunicationToken = token, Interlocutor = Interlocutor.Runtime });
}
private class TestMessage : Message { };
}
}

/*
* Copyright (c) 2024 ETH Zürich, IT Services
*
* This Source Code Form is subject to the terms of the Mozilla Public
* License, v. 2.0. If a copy of the MPL was not distributed with this
* file, You can obtain one at http://mozilla.org/MPL/2.0/.
*/
using System;
using System.Collections.Generic;
using System.Linq;
using Microsoft.VisualStudio.TestTools.UnitTesting;
using Moq;
using SafeExamBrowser.Configuration.Contracts;
using SafeExamBrowser.Core.Contracts.OperationModel;
using SafeExamBrowser.Lockdown.Contracts;
using SafeExamBrowser.Logging.Contracts;
using SafeExamBrowser.Service.Operations;
using SafeExamBrowser.Settings;
namespace SafeExamBrowser.Service.UnitTests.Operations
{
[TestClass]
public class LockdownOperationTests
{
private Mock<IFeatureConfigurationBackup> backup;
private Mock<IFeatureConfigurationFactory> factory;
private Mock<IFeatureConfigurationMonitor> monitor;
private Mock<ILogger> logger;
private AppSettings settings;
private SessionContext sessionContext;
private LockdownOperation sut;
[TestInitialize]
public void Initialize()
{
backup = new Mock<IFeatureConfigurationBackup>();
factory = new Mock<IFeatureConfigurationFactory>();
monitor = new Mock<IFeatureConfigurationMonitor>();
logger = new Mock<ILogger>();
settings = new AppSettings();
sessionContext = new SessionContext
{
Configuration = new ServiceConfiguration { Settings = settings, UserName = "TestName", UserSid = "S-1-234-TEST" }
};
sut = new LockdownOperation(backup.Object, factory.Object, monitor.Object, logger.Object, sessionContext);
}
[TestMethod]
public void Perform_MustSetConfigurationsCorrectly()
{
var configuration = new Mock<IFeatureConfiguration>();
var count = typeof(IFeatureConfigurationFactory).GetMethods().Where(m => m.Name.StartsWith("Create") && m.Name != nameof(IFeatureConfigurationFactory.CreateAll)).Count();
configuration.SetReturnsDefault(true);
factory.SetReturnsDefault(configuration.Object);
settings.Service.DisableChromeNotifications = true;
settings.Service.DisableEaseOfAccessOptions = true;
settings.Service.DisableSignout = true;
settings.Service.SetVmwareConfiguration = true;
var result = sut.Perform();
backup.Verify(b => b.Save(It.Is<IFeatureConfiguration>(c => c == configuration.Object)), Times.Exactly(count));
configuration.Verify(c => c.Initialize(), Times.Exactly(count));
configuration.Verify(c => c.DisableFeature(), Times.Exactly(3));
configuration.Verify(c => c.EnableFeature(), Times.Exactly(count - 3));
monitor.Verify(m => m.Observe(It.Is<IFeatureConfiguration>(c => c == configuration.Object), It.Is<FeatureConfigurationStatus>(s => s == FeatureConfigurationStatus.Disabled)), Times.Exactly(3));
monitor.Verify(m => m.Observe(It.Is<IFeatureConfiguration>(c => c == configuration.Object), It.Is<FeatureConfigurationStatus>(s => s == FeatureConfigurationStatus.Enabled)), Times.Exactly(count - 3));
monitor.Verify(m => m.Start(), Times.Once);
Assert.AreEqual(OperationResult.Success, result);
}
[TestMethod]
public void Perform_MustOnlySetVmwareConfigurationIfEnabled()
{
var configuration = new Mock<IFeatureConfiguration>();
configuration.SetReturnsDefault(true);
factory.SetReturnsDefault(configuration.Object);
settings.Service.SetVmwareConfiguration = true;
sut.Perform();
factory.Verify(f => f.CreateVmwareOverlayConfiguration(It.IsAny<Guid>(), It.IsAny<string>(), It.IsAny<string>()), Times.Once);
factory.Reset();
factory.SetReturnsDefault(configuration.Object);
settings.Service.SetVmwareConfiguration = false;
sut.Perform();
factory.Verify(f => f.CreateVmwareOverlayConfiguration(It.IsAny<Guid>(), It.IsAny<string>(), It.IsAny<string>()), Times.Never);
}
[TestMethod]
public void Perform_MustUseSameGroupForAllConfigurations()
{
var configuration = new Mock<IFeatureConfiguration>();
var groupId = default(Guid);
configuration.SetReturnsDefault(true);
factory
.Setup(f => f.CreateChromeNotificationConfiguration(It.IsAny<Guid>(), It.IsAny<string>(), It.IsAny<string>()))
.Returns(configuration.Object)
.Callback<Guid, string, string>((id, name, sid) => groupId = id);
factory.SetReturnsDefault(configuration.Object);
settings.Service.SetVmwareConfiguration = true;
sut.Perform();
factory.Verify(f => f.CreateChangePasswordConfiguration(It.Is<Guid>(id => id == groupId), It.IsAny<string>(), It.IsAny<string>()), Times.Once);
factory.Verify(f => f.CreateChromeNotificationConfiguration(It.Is<Guid>(id => id == groupId), It.IsAny<string>(), It.IsAny<string>()), Times.Once);
factory.Verify(f => f.CreateEaseOfAccessConfiguration(It.Is<Guid>(id => id == groupId)), Times.Once);
factory.Verify(f => f.CreateFindPrinterConfiguration(It.Is<Guid>(id => id == groupId), It.IsAny<string>(), It.IsAny<string>()), Times.Once);
factory.Verify(f => f.CreateLockWorkstationConfiguration(It.Is<Guid>(id => id == groupId), It.IsAny<string>(), It.IsAny<string>()), Times.Once);
factory.Verify(f => f.CreateMachinePowerOptionsConfiguration(It.Is<Guid>(id => id == groupId)), Times.Once);
factory.Verify(f => f.CreateNetworkOptionsConfiguration(It.Is<Guid>(id => id == groupId)), Times.Once);
factory.Verify(f => f.CreateRemoteConnectionConfiguration(It.Is<Guid>(id => id == groupId)), Times.Once);
factory.Verify(f => f.CreateSignoutConfiguration(It.Is<Guid>(id => id == groupId), It.IsAny<string>(), It.IsAny<string>()), Times.Once);
factory.Verify(f => f.CreateSwitchUserConfiguration(It.Is<Guid>(id => id == groupId)), Times.Once);
factory.Verify(f => f.CreateTaskManagerConfiguration(It.Is<Guid>(id => id == groupId), It.IsAny<string>(), It.IsAny<string>()), Times.Once);
factory.Verify(f => f.CreateUserPowerOptionsConfiguration(It.Is<Guid>(id => id == groupId), It.IsAny<string>(), It.IsAny<string>()), Times.Once);
factory.Verify(f => f.CreateVmwareOverlayConfiguration(It.Is<Guid>(id => id == groupId), It.IsAny<string>(), It.IsAny<string>()), Times.Once);
factory.Verify(f => f.CreateWindowsUpdateConfiguration(It.Is<Guid>(id => id == groupId)), Times.Once);
}
[TestMethod]
public void Perform_MustImmediatelyAbortOnFailure()
{
var configuration = new Mock<IFeatureConfiguration>();
var count = typeof(IFeatureConfigurationFactory).GetMethods().Where(m => m.Name.StartsWith("Create") && m.Name != nameof(IFeatureConfigurationFactory.CreateAll)).Count();
var counter = 0;
var offset = 3;
configuration.Setup(c => c.EnableFeature()).Returns(() => ++counter < count - offset);
factory.SetReturnsDefault(configuration.Object);
var result = sut.Perform();
backup.Verify(b => b.Save(It.Is<IFeatureConfiguration>(c => c == configuration.Object)), Times.Exactly(count - offset));
configuration.Verify(c => c.Initialize(), Times.Exactly(count - offset));
configuration.Verify(c => c.DisableFeature(), Times.Never);
configuration.Verify(c => c.EnableFeature(), Times.Exactly(count - offset));
monitor.Verify(m => m.Observe(It.Is<IFeatureConfiguration>(c => c == configuration.Object), It.Is<FeatureConfigurationStatus>(s => s == FeatureConfigurationStatus.Enabled)), Times.Exactly(count - offset - 1));
monitor.Verify(m => m.Start(), Times.Never);
Assert.AreEqual(OperationResult.Failed, result);
}
[TestMethod]
public void Revert_MustRestoreConfigurationsCorrectly()
{
var configuration1 = new Mock<IFeatureConfiguration>();
var configuration2 = new Mock<IFeatureConfiguration>();
var configuration3 = new Mock<IFeatureConfiguration>();
var configuration4 = new Mock<IFeatureConfiguration>();
var configurations = new List<IFeatureConfiguration>
{
configuration1.Object,
configuration2.Object,
configuration3.Object,
configuration4.Object
};
backup.Setup(b => b.GetBy(It.IsAny<Guid>())).Returns(configurations);
configuration1.Setup(c => c.Restore()).Returns(true);
configuration2.Setup(c => c.Restore()).Returns(true);
configuration3.Setup(c => c.Restore()).Returns(true);
configuration4.Setup(c => c.Restore()).Returns(true);
var result = sut.Revert();
backup.Verify(b => b.Delete(It.Is<IFeatureConfiguration>(c => c == configuration1.Object)), Times.Once);
backup.Verify(b => b.Delete(It.Is<IFeatureConfiguration>(c => c == configuration2.Object)), Times.Once);
backup.Verify(b => b.Delete(It.Is<IFeatureConfiguration>(c => c == configuration3.Object)), Times.Once);
backup.Verify(b => b.Delete(It.Is<IFeatureConfiguration>(c => c == configuration4.Object)), Times.Once);
configuration1.Verify(c => c.DisableFeature(), Times.Never);
configuration1.Verify(c => c.EnableFeature(), Times.Never);
configuration1.Verify(c => c.Initialize(), Times.Never);
configuration1.Verify(c => c.Restore(), Times.Once);
configuration2.Verify(c => c.DisableFeature(), Times.Never);
configuration2.Verify(c => c.EnableFeature(), Times.Never);
configuration2.Verify(c => c.Initialize(), Times.Never);
configuration2.Verify(c => c.Restore(), Times.Once);
configuration3.Verify(c => c.DisableFeature(), Times.Never);
configuration3.Verify(c => c.EnableFeature(), Times.Never);
configuration3.Verify(c => c.Initialize(), Times.Never);
configuration3.Verify(c => c.Restore(), Times.Once);
configuration4.Verify(c => c.DisableFeature(), Times.Never);
configuration4.Verify(c => c.EnableFeature(), Times.Never);
configuration4.Verify(c => c.Initialize(), Times.Never);
configuration4.Verify(c => c.Restore(), Times.Once);
monitor.Verify(m => m.Reset(), Times.Once);
Assert.AreEqual(OperationResult.Success, result);
}
[TestMethod]
public void Revert_MustContinueToRevertOnFailure()
{
var configuration1 = new Mock<IFeatureConfiguration>();
var configuration2 = new Mock<IFeatureConfiguration>();
var configuration3 = new Mock<IFeatureConfiguration>();
var configuration4 = new Mock<IFeatureConfiguration>();
var configurations = new List<IFeatureConfiguration>
{
configuration1.Object,
configuration2.Object,
configuration3.Object,
configuration4.Object
};
backup.Setup(b => b.GetBy(It.IsAny<Guid>())).Returns(configurations);
configuration1.Setup(c => c.Restore()).Returns(true);
configuration2.Setup(c => c.Restore()).Returns(false);
configuration3.Setup(c => c.Restore()).Returns(false);
configuration4.Setup(c => c.Restore()).Returns(true);
var result = sut.Revert();
backup.Verify(b => b.Delete(It.Is<IFeatureConfiguration>(c => c == configuration1.Object)), Times.Once);
backup.Verify(b => b.Delete(It.Is<IFeatureConfiguration>(c => c == configuration2.Object)), Times.Never);
backup.Verify(b => b.Delete(It.Is<IFeatureConfiguration>(c => c == configuration3.Object)), Times.Never);
backup.Verify(b => b.Delete(It.Is<IFeatureConfiguration>(c => c == configuration4.Object)), Times.Once);
configuration1.Verify(c => c.DisableFeature(), Times.Never);
configuration1.Verify(c => c.EnableFeature(), Times.Never);
configuration1.Verify(c => c.Initialize(), Times.Never);
configuration1.Verify(c => c.Restore(), Times.Once);
configuration2.Verify(c => c.DisableFeature(), Times.Never);
configuration2.Verify(c => c.EnableFeature(), Times.Never);
configuration2.Verify(c => c.Initialize(), Times.Never);
configuration2.Verify(c => c.Restore(), Times.Once);
configuration3.Verify(c => c.DisableFeature(), Times.Never);
configuration3.Verify(c => c.EnableFeature(), Times.Never);
configuration3.Verify(c => c.Initialize(), Times.Never);
configuration3.Verify(c => c.Restore(), Times.Once);
configuration4.Verify(c => c.DisableFeature(), Times.Never);
configuration4.Verify(c => c.EnableFeature(), Times.Never);
configuration4.Verify(c => c.Initialize(), Times.Never);
configuration4.Verify(c => c.Restore(), Times.Once);
monitor.Verify(m => m.Reset(), Times.Once);
Assert.AreEqual(OperationResult.Failed, result);
}
}
}

/*
* Copyright (c) 2024 ETH Zürich, IT Services
*
* This Source Code Form is subject to the terms of the Mozilla Public
* License, v. 2.0. If a copy of the MPL was not distributed with this
* file, You can obtain one at http://mozilla.org/MPL/2.0/.
*/
using System;
using System.Threading;
using Microsoft.VisualStudio.TestTools.UnitTesting;
using Moq;
using SafeExamBrowser.Communication.Contracts.Events;
using SafeExamBrowser.Communication.Contracts.Hosts;
using SafeExamBrowser.Configuration.Contracts;
using SafeExamBrowser.Core.Contracts.OperationModel;
using SafeExamBrowser.Lockdown.Contracts;
using SafeExamBrowser.Logging.Contracts;
using SafeExamBrowser.Settings;
using SafeExamBrowser.Settings.Logging;
namespace SafeExamBrowser.Service.UnitTests
{
[TestClass]
public class ServiceControllerTests
{
private Mock<ILogger> logger;
private Mock<Func<string, ILogObserver>> logWriterFactory;
private Mock<IOperationSequence> bootstrapSequence;
private SessionContext sessionContext;
private Mock<IOperationSequence> sessionSequence;
private Mock<IServiceHost> serviceHost;
private Mock<ISystemConfigurationUpdate> systemConfigurationUpdate;
private ServiceController sut;
[TestInitialize]
public void Initialize()
{
logger = new Mock<ILogger>();
logWriterFactory = new Mock<Func<string, ILogObserver>>();
bootstrapSequence = new Mock<IOperationSequence>();
sessionContext = new SessionContext();
sessionSequence = new Mock<IOperationSequence>();
serviceHost = new Mock<IServiceHost>();
systemConfigurationUpdate = new Mock<ISystemConfigurationUpdate>();
logWriterFactory.Setup(f => f.Invoke(It.IsAny<string>())).Returns(new Mock<ILogObserver>().Object);
sut = new ServiceController(
logger.Object,
logWriterFactory.Object,
bootstrapSequence.Object,
sessionSequence.Object,
serviceHost.Object,
sessionContext,
systemConfigurationUpdate.Object);
}
[TestMethod]
public void Communication_MustStartNewSessionUponRequest()
{
var args = new SessionStartEventArgs { Configuration = new ServiceConfiguration { SessionId = Guid.NewGuid() } };
bootstrapSequence.Setup(b => b.TryPerform()).Returns(OperationResult.Success);
sessionSequence.Setup(b => b.TryPerform()).Returns(OperationResult.Success);
sut.TryStart();
serviceHost.Raise(h => h.SessionStartRequested += null, args);
sessionSequence.Verify(s => s.TryPerform(), Times.Once);
Assert.IsNotNull(sessionContext.Configuration);
Assert.AreEqual(args.Configuration.SessionId, sessionContext.Configuration.SessionId);
}
[TestMethod]
public void Communication_MustInitializeSessionLogging()
{
var args = new SessionStartEventArgs
{
Configuration = new ServiceConfiguration
{
AppConfig = new AppConfig { ServiceLogFilePath = "Test.log" },
SessionId = Guid.NewGuid(),
Settings = new AppSettings { LogLevel = LogLevel.Warning }
}
};
bootstrapSequence.Setup(b => b.TryPerform()).Returns(OperationResult.Success);
sessionSequence.Setup(b => b.TryPerform()).Returns(OperationResult.Success);
sut.TryStart();
serviceHost.Raise(h => h.SessionStartRequested += null, args);
logger.VerifySet(l => l.LogLevel = It.Is<LogLevel>(ll => ll == args.Configuration.Settings.LogLevel), Times.Once);
}
[TestMethod]
public void Communication_MustNotAllowNewSessionDuringActiveSession()
{
var args = new SessionStartEventArgs { Configuration = new ServiceConfiguration { SessionId = Guid.NewGuid() } };
bootstrapSequence.Setup(b => b.TryPerform()).Returns(OperationResult.Success);
sessionContext.Configuration = new ServiceConfiguration { SessionId = Guid.NewGuid() };
sessionContext.IsRunning = true;
sut.TryStart();
serviceHost.Raise(h => h.SessionStartRequested += null, args);
sessionSequence.Verify(s => s.TryPerform(), Times.Never);
Assert.AreNotEqual(args.Configuration.SessionId, sessionContext.Configuration.SessionId);
}
[TestMethod]
public void Communication_MustNotFailIfNoValidSessionData()
{
var args = new SessionStartEventArgs { Configuration = null };
bootstrapSequence.Setup(b => b.TryPerform()).Returns(OperationResult.Success);
sessionSequence.Setup(b => b.TryPerform()).Returns(OperationResult.Success);
sut.TryStart();
serviceHost.Raise(h => h.SessionStartRequested += null, args);
sessionSequence.Verify(s => s.TryPerform(), Times.Once);
Assert.IsNull(sessionContext.Configuration);
}
[TestMethod]
public void Communication_MustStopActiveSessionUponRequest()
{
var args = new SessionStopEventArgs { SessionId = Guid.NewGuid() };
bootstrapSequence.Setup(b => b.TryPerform()).Returns(OperationResult.Success);
sessionContext.Configuration = new ServiceConfiguration { SessionId = args.SessionId };
sessionContext.IsRunning = true;
sut.TryStart();
serviceHost.Raise(h => h.SessionStopRequested += null, args);
sessionSequence.Verify(s => s.TryRevert(), Times.Once);
}
[TestMethod]
public void Communication_MustNotStopSessionWithWrongId()
{
var args = new SessionStopEventArgs { SessionId = Guid.NewGuid() };
bootstrapSequence.Setup(b => b.TryPerform()).Returns(OperationResult.Success);
sessionContext.Configuration = new ServiceConfiguration { SessionId = Guid.NewGuid() };
sessionContext.IsRunning = true;
sut.TryStart();
serviceHost.Raise(h => h.SessionStopRequested += null, args);
sessionSequence.Verify(s => s.TryRevert(), Times.Never);
}
[TestMethod]
public void Communication_MustNotStopSessionWithoutActiveSession()
{
var args = new SessionStopEventArgs { SessionId = Guid.NewGuid() };
bootstrapSequence.Setup(b => b.TryPerform()).Returns(OperationResult.Success);
sessionContext.IsRunning = false;
sut.TryStart();
serviceHost.Raise(h => h.SessionStopRequested += null, args);
sessionSequence.Verify(s => s.TryRevert(), Times.Never);
}
[TestMethod]
public void Communication_MustStartSystemConfigurationUpdate()
{
var sync = new AutoResetEvent(false);
bootstrapSequence.Setup(b => b.TryPerform()).Returns(OperationResult.Success);
systemConfigurationUpdate.Setup(u => u.ExecuteAsync()).Callback(() => sync.Set());
sut.TryStart();
serviceHost.Raise(h => h.SystemConfigurationUpdateRequested += null);
sync.WaitOne();
systemConfigurationUpdate.Verify(u => u.Execute(), Times.Never);
systemConfigurationUpdate.Verify(u => u.ExecuteAsync(), Times.Once);
}
[TestMethod]
public void Start_MustOnlyPerformBootstrapSequence()
{
bootstrapSequence.Setup(b => b.TryPerform()).Returns(OperationResult.Success);
sessionSequence.Setup(b => b.TryPerform()).Returns(OperationResult.Success);
sessionContext.Configuration = null;
var success = sut.TryStart();
bootstrapSequence.Verify(b => b.TryPerform(), Times.Once);
bootstrapSequence.Verify(b => b.TryRevert(), Times.Never);
sessionSequence.Verify(b => b.TryPerform(), Times.Never);
sessionSequence.Verify(b => b.TryRevert(), Times.Never);
Assert.IsTrue(success);
}
[TestMethod]
public void Stop_MustRevertSessionThenBootstrapSequence()
{
var order = 0;
var bootstrap = 0;
var session = 0;
sut.TryStart();
bootstrapSequence.Reset();
sessionSequence.Reset();
bootstrapSequence.Setup(b => b.TryRevert()).Returns(OperationResult.Success).Callback(() => bootstrap = ++order);
sessionSequence.Setup(b => b.TryRevert()).Returns(OperationResult.Success).Callback(() => session = ++order);
sessionContext.Configuration = new ServiceConfiguration();
sessionContext.IsRunning = true;
sut.Terminate();
bootstrapSequence.Verify(b => b.TryPerform(), Times.Never);
bootstrapSequence.Verify(b => b.TryRevert(), Times.Once);
sessionSequence.Verify(b => b.TryPerform(), Times.Never);
sessionSequence.Verify(b => b.TryRevert(), Times.Once);
Assert.AreEqual(1, session);
Assert.AreEqual(2, bootstrap);
}
[TestMethod]
public void Stop_MustNotRevertSessionSequenceIfNoSessionRunning()
{
var order = 0;
var bootstrap = 0;
var session = 0;
sut.TryStart();
bootstrapSequence.Reset();
sessionSequence.Reset();
bootstrapSequence.Setup(b => b.TryRevert()).Returns(OperationResult.Success).Callback(() => bootstrap = ++order);
sessionSequence.Setup(b => b.TryRevert()).Returns(OperationResult.Success).Callback(() => session = ++order);
sessionContext.Configuration = null;
sut.Terminate();
bootstrapSequence.Verify(b => b.TryPerform(), Times.Never);
bootstrapSequence.Verify(b => b.TryRevert(), Times.Once);
sessionSequence.Verify(b => b.TryPerform(), Times.Never);
sessionSequence.Verify(b => b.TryRevert(), Times.Never);
Assert.AreEqual(0, session);
Assert.AreEqual(1, bootstrap);
}
}
}
